Dรฉtails du cours
โข Advanced Sensor Technology in Smart Farming: This unit will cover the latest sensor technologies used in smart farming, including their installation, calibration, and maintenance. It will also discuss the role of sensors in data collection for soundscape analysis.
โข Soundscape Analysis for Crop Health Monitoring: This unit will explore the use of soundscape analysis in monitoring crop health. Students will learn about the various sound sources in a farming environment and how to analyze them to detect potential issues early.
โข Machine Learning and AI in Smart Farm Soundscapes: This unit will delve into the application of machine learning and artificial intelligence in interpreting soundscape data. It will cover topics such as data pattern recognition, predictive modeling, and automated decision-making.
โข IoT Architecture and Data Management in Smart Farms: This unit will discuss the Internet of Things (IoT) architecture and data management strategies in smart farms. It will cover data security, privacy, and interoperability issues.
โข Precision Agriculture and Soundscape-based Yield Optimization: This unit will focus on the integration of soundscape analysis in precision agriculture for optimized yields. It will cover topics such as variable rate technology, site-specific crop management, and yield mapping.
โข Advanced Data Visualization Techniques for Soundscape Analysis: This unit will teach students advanced data visualization techniques for interpreting and presenting soundscape data. It will cover topics such as data sonification, 3D modeling, and virtual reality.
โข Legal and Ethical Considerations in Smart Farm Soundscapes: This unit will discuss the legal and ethical considerations surrounding the use of soundscape analysis in smart farming. It will cover topics such as data ownership, privacy, and the ethical use of AI.
โข Case Studies in Smart Farm Soundscapes: This unit will present real-world case studies of smart farm soundscape implementations. Students will analyze these cases to understand the practical challenges and benefits of implementing such systems.
